However, I also considered using this for sweatshirt embroidery. Here, the fabric texture changes the game. A fleece or cotton-blend sweatshirt is softer and more prone to puckering if the stabilizer is not chosen correctly. For a project like this, I would recommend a cut-away stabilizer to support the weight of the stitches, ensuring that the design remains crisp and does not distort after washing. Navigating Technical Challenges

While Bichon Fries Dog T-shirt Design 2 is versatile, it is not without its challenges. One area where I would exercise caution is with small hoop sizes. If you are trying to fit this onto a cap or a small pocket, you must ensure that the details do not become too compressed. Tiny lettering or intricate corners can easily turn into a blob of thread if the resolution is not maintained. I always advise checking the actual dimensions of the design in your embroidery software before hooping. If the design is too large for a 4x4 hoop, you may need to resize it, but be careful not to make the stitches so small that they break or bunch up.

Another consideration is fabric choice. While this design would look fantastic on a sturdy apron or a pillow cover, it might struggle on thin, stretchy fabrics like rayon or lightweight jersey unless proper precautions are taken. On stretchy fabric, the tension of the threads can cause the garment to warp. In such cases, using a water-soluble topping can help keep the stitches sitting on top of the fabric rather than sinking into the nap, preserving the clarity of the dog’s features. Additionally, for dark fabrics, you must consider the underlay stitches. A proper underlay will prevent the background color from showing through the lighter threads of the Bichon’s fur, ensuring the design looks vibrant and professional.

Practical Designer Notes

Before you start stitching, here are my top recommendations for getting the best results with Bichon Fries Dog T-shirt Design 2:

The product description mentions that you will receive PNG, SVG, EPS, and DXF files. While these are excellent for printing and cutting, remember that for machine embroidery, you typically need specific formats like PES, DST, or JEF. If those are not explicitly listed, you may need to use digitizing software to convert the vector files (SVG/EPS) into an embroidery format, or confirm with the seller if additional embroidery-specific files are included. This step is critical for ensuring the design is ready for your machine.
